Fb and Instagram’s father or mother firm Meta is shifting its content material moderators from California to Texas, the tech big introduced Tuesday morning as a part of its plan to finish its third-party fact-checking program.

Meta is about to interchange its fact-checking initiative with Group Notes, a function that permits customers so as to add reality checks as context to what they take into account deceptive posts. The social media platform X has applied the same function lately.

Shifting Meta’s belief and security and content material moderation groups to Texas will scale back bias considerations, CEO and founder Mark Zuckerberg stated in a video posted to Fb Tuesday morning. Zuckerberg stated Meta will even be eradicating some content material restrictions from its platforms on matters like immigration and gender.

Meta didn’t instantly reply to questions on what number of workers would transfer to Texas or how the corporate expects the transfer will enhance the groups’ operations.

Zuckerberg isn’t the primary massive tech CEO to maneuver a few of his staff’s operations to Texas. In July final yr, Tesla CEO and Trump ally Elon Musk moved the corporate’s headquarters to Austin in 2021. He additionally introduced plans to maneuver X and SpaceX from California to Texas.

Meta’s relationship with Texas has been rocky at instances. In July final yr, Meta was pressured to pay the state $1.4 billion to settle a lawsuit wherein the tech big was accused of utilizing private biometric knowledge with out customers’ authorization.

Meta’s efforts to roll again its fact-checking techniques come as the corporate is attempting to fix bridges with President-elect Donald Trump’s incoming administration. Fb banned Trump following the Jan. 6, 2021, riots; in latest months, Zuckerberg has grown nearer to the president-elect, with Meta donating $1 million to Trump’s inaugural fund. And on Monday, Zuckerberg introduced he was including Dana White, a key Trump ally and CEO of Final Preventing Championship, to Meta’s board.

Zuckerberg instantly referenced Trump in Tuesday’s video, saying that Meta would “work with President Trump to push back on governments around the world going after American companies and pushing to censor more.”

The choice to finish the fact-checking program is a full circle second for an initiative that started in December 2016 in response to claims of on-line misinformation connected to the presidential election that yr, which Trump gained. Zuckerberg stated the fact-checkers since then have been “too politically biased and have destroyed more trust than they have created.”

Additionally on Tuesday, Joel Kaplan — Meta’s new chief international affairs officer — criticized President Joe Biden’s administration throughout a Tuesday interview on “Fox and Friends for “pushing for censorship.” Zuckerberg has beforehand stated that he felt pressured by the Biden administration to censor COVID-19-related content material in 2021.
